Introduction

Toddler climbing frames are essential for promoting active play and development in young children. These structures not only provide a safe space for toddlers to explore their climbing skills but also help improve their motor skills, balance, and coordination. With a variety of designs available, parents can choose the perfect toddler climbing frame that fits their child's needs and their outdoor or indoor space.

Here are some key benefits of toddler climbing frames:
  • Encourages physical activity and reduces screen time.
  • Boosts confidence as children master new climbing challenges.
  • Promotes social skills through cooperative play with peers.
  • Enhances cognitive development as toddlers engage in problem-solving while climbing.

When selecting a toddler climbing frame, consider the following features:
  • Safety certifications to ensure the frame meets industry standards.
  • Age-appropriate design that caters specifically to toddlers.
  • Durable materials that withstand weather conditions if used outdoors.
  • Easy assembly and disassembly for convenience.

FAQs

How can I choose the best toddler climbing frame for my needs?

Consider your child's age, size, and interests. Look for frames with safety features, age-appropriate designs, and durable materials to ensure a safe and enjoyable experience.

What are the key features to look for when selecting toddler climbing frames?

Key features include safety certifications, sturdy construction, non-toxic materials, and engaging designs that encourage exploration and play.

Are there any common mistakes people make when purchasing toddler climbing frames?

Common mistakes include choosing a frame that is too advanced for the child's age, neglecting safety features, or failing to consider the available space for installation.

How do I ensure the safety of my child while using a climbing frame?

Supervise your child during play, ensure the frame is installed on a soft surface, and regularly check for any wear and tear that could pose a risk.

Can toddler climbing frames be used indoors?

Yes, many toddler climbing frames are designed for indoor use. Ensure you have enough space and a safe environment for your child to play.
